The Nilgiris: Over two years, Coonoor has been facing severe water crisis. Inadequate drinking water supply was one of the main poll issues and administrative issues, as far as people of Coonoor were concerned.
The main source of water for Coonoor municipality is from Raliah dam and Gymkhana canal which is stored in the Grace Hill water tank. From the Grace Hill water tank, water is disbursed to the 30 wards in Coonoor.
In this state, there has been continuous waste of water from a water tank for the last 20 days and people have alleged that authorities have not attended to this issue.
In this network of supply, the water tank near Ottupattarai Morris Garden has been overflowing and wasting gallons drinking water. Despite alerting the officials, the public allege the issue was left unattended.

"While the town is reeling under water crisis, such callousness in attending to the issue by the municipality officials is shocking. There are wards who get water once once in 18 days. In this scenario, such wastages should be addressed on priority", opined a resident of Ottupattarai.
